[Scummvm-cvs-logs] SF.net SVN: scummvm: [28316] scummvm/trunk/engines/parallaction/staticres. cpp
peres001 at users.sourceforge.net
peres001 at users.sourceforge.net
Sun Jul 29 21:56:07 CEST 2007
Revision: 28316
http://scummvm.svn.sourceforge.net/scummvm/?rev=28316&view=rev
Author: peres001
Date: 2007-07-29 12:56:06 -0700 (Sun, 29 Jul 2007)
Log Message:
-----------
Now callables array is properly initialized.
Modified Paths:
--------------
scummvm/trunk/engines/parallaction/staticres.cpp
Modified: scummvm/trunk/engines/parallaction/staticres.cpp
===================================================================
--- scummvm/trunk/engines/parallaction/staticres.cpp 2007-07-29 19:17:53 UTC (rev 28315)
+++ scummvm/trunk/engines/parallaction/staticres.cpp 2007-07-29 19:56:06 UTC (rev 28316)
@@ -483,7 +483,9 @@
const char *_minidrkiName = "minidrki";
#define CALLABLE_NS(x) &Parallaction_ns::x
+#define CALLABLE_BR(x) &Parallaction_br::x
+
void Parallaction_ns::initResources() {
_zoneFlagNamesRes = _zoneFlagNamesRes_ns;
@@ -577,7 +579,14 @@
_localFlagNames = new Table(120);
_localFlagNames->addData("visited");
- // TODO: init callables for Big Red Adventure
+ if (getPlatform() == Common::kPlatformPC) {
+ _callables[0] = CALLABLE_BR(_c_blufade);
+ _callables[1] = CALLABLE_BR(_c_resetpalette);
+ _callables[2] = CALLABLE_BR(_c_ferrcycle);
+ _callables[3] = CALLABLE_BR(_c_lipsinc);
+ _callables[4] = CALLABLE_BR(_c_albcycle);
+ _callables[5] = CALLABLE_BR(_c_password);
+ }
}
This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.
More information about the Scummvm-git-logs
mailing list